Practical Nursing at Confederation College at Fort Frances Rainy River District

Confederation College’s Practical Nursing program is a two-year program with an emphasis on providing nursing care to stable, predictable patients across their lifespan.

The Practical Nurse Program at Confederation College is approved by the College of Nurses of Ontario. Current graduates from this program are eligible to apply for registration as a Registered Practical Nurse in Ontario.

Courses in the Practical Nursing program cover a wide variety of topics including nursing theory, human relationships, technical concepts in health care, anatomy, physiology, health assessment, and pharmacology. Students will develop the nursing skills needed to help people at various stages of life and health. They may also want to consider our Collaborative Bachelor of Science in Nursing four-year degree program, a joint program with Lakehead University. The collaborative BScN program offers more comprehensive learning and the advantage of two institutions with a rich history in nursing education. It also provides students with more career opportunities.

Level Diploma
Discipline Medicine and Health Sciences
Duration 24 months
Intakes Jan, Sep
Application Fees CAD 95
Tuition Fees CAD 18291
Campus Fort Frances Rainy River District

Admission Requirements
Language proficiency (minimum)
IELTS 6.5
TOEFL 88
PTE 60
Duolingo 125
Exam proficiency (minimum)
SAT Not Required / Waiver
ACT Not Required / Waiver
GRE Not Required / Waiver
GMAT Not Required / Waiver
Requirements

Minimum GPA - 79%

Shanghai Ranking

The Academic Ranking of World Universities (ARWU) was first published in June 2003 by the Center for World-Class Universities (CWCU), Graduate School of Education (formerly the Institute of Higher Education) of Shanghai Jiao Tong University, China, and updated on an annual basis

Webometrics Ranking

The "Webometrics Ranking of World Universities" is an initiative of the Cybermetrics Lab, a research group belonging to the Consejo Superior de Investigaciones Científicas (CSIC), the largest public research body in Spain. CSIC is among the first basic research organizations in Europe. The CSIC consisted in 2006 of 126 centers and institutes distributed throughout Spain.
